It's a 5am start for people heading out on the bird watching tour but time and again Thomas Griesohn-Pflieger is amazed by how many show up regardless, eager to hear a new kind of birdsong.
Griesohn-Pflieger co-founded Birdingtours, a German provider specialising in bird watching trips and excursions. Participants start with two hours of hiking, followed by breakfast at a hotel, before they even get near the birds.
